Seared Salmon Fillet with Steamed Asparagus and Cauliflower Mash
Enjoy a beautifully seared salmon fillet, perfectly paired with tender steamed asparagus and a creamy cauliflower mash enhanced with a touch of nonfat Greek yogurt. This dish boasts vibrant textures and flavors, making it an elegant yet nutritious dinner choice.
INGREDIENTS
9 oz Atlantic Salmon Fillet
5 spears Asparagus
1 cup Cauliflower
1/4 cup Nonfat Greek Yogurt
2 teaspoons Olive Oil
PREPARATION
Pat the salmon dry with paper towels and season lightly with salt and pepper.
Heat 1 teaspo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, add the salmon fillet skin-side down and sear for about 4-5 minutes, then turn and cook the other side for 3-4 minutes or until cooked to your preferred doneness.
Meanwhile, trim the woody ends off the asparagus and steam them for about 4-5 minutes until tender but still crisp.
Steam or boil the cauliflower florets until very tender, about 8-10 minutes.
Drain the cauliflower and transfer to a bowl. Add the nonfat Greek yogurt, a pinch of salt, and a dash of pepper, then mash until smooth and creamy.
Drizzle the remaining 1 teaspoon of olive oil over the steamed asparagus for extra flavor.
Plate the salmon alongside the asparagus and a generous serving of cauliflower mash, and serve immediately.
